About Leisure & Tourism Management, BA - at EU Business School, Munich

With this bachelor's degree, students will get an in-depth and practical understanding of hospitality management; quality of service; event and conference planning; and sustainability as it applies to tourism. The overview of these key business areas ensures that students gain a deep understanding of the industry. Case studies allow students to apply theoretical knowledge to real-world scenarios and find appropriate solutions.

Students may choose to study either the six-semester program (option 1) with 210 ECTS or the seven-semester program (option 2) with 240 ECTS.

Why study at EU Business School, Munich

  • All Classes Taught in English: Including assignments, lectures, exams and the final dissertation
  • Enhance your career prospect: EU offers advice to students on a one-to-one basis and in group sessions to enhance their career prospects and ensure their job search is successful
  • International education in European cities: EU Business School has four campuses located in Spain (Barcelona), Switzerland (Geneva), Germany (Munich) and Digital
  • International Community: Our student body comprises more than 100 nationalities, with 98% of students speaking two or more languages
  • Experiential Learning: The case study method and a pragmatic approach are two of our most effective tools
